i used a ultrasonic
and i never EVER misted, and i got upwards of 2 oz off of 5 1/2 pint cakes

if u sent it up BEFORE you birth, and get the humidity settings right so that it keeps condensation on the walls to a degree (slight condensation, not dripping), then you'll be fine. I just ran mine for 2 min (gets humidity to proper level) every 2 hours all day. I even put perlite in there to stabilize the humidity. Worked great for me. I don't see a need to MIST and to use ultrasonic.

imho:

for cakes: no, if the rh stays at 95 or higher. if you're humidity is high enough for cakes, what is the point of misting?

for casings: yes, because the casing layer will still dry out at 85 to 95 % rh.
